lbwhite89 answered Tuesday June 26 2007, 6:26 pm:
No, it's natural. You can't help it. But if you know you can't have the person, then you'll eventually have to get over them. It takes time though, so don't worry too much about it.

LM answered Tuesday June 26 2007, 6:25 pm:
No, unless it's affecting your daily life. It takes a long time to get over someone, or for the reality that you can't have them to sink in. Plus, some people have a tendency to want who [or what] they can't have, and there's not really much you can do about that.


Just try to focus on other things/people/shiny objects/ anything that could distract you. You'll move on =]
